Transaction 58e89147de32e72588e8dad8eb45fd31bb495f4bda9e6cd787b46e3a96410c47

13 Input
2 Outputs
  • 58e89147de32e72588e8dad8eb45fd31bb495f4bda9e6cd787b46e3a96410c47:0
  • value  26794
    address  3HMsygrcCUioXs9bTRNcZpwPBBvtLG5TfG
  • 58e89147de32e72588e8dad8eb45fd31bb495f4bda9e6cd787b46e3a96410c47:1
  • value  5904811
    address  38MshpxCeaXbJfcaBpQo6prxAu23KTcBad